本文目錄一覽:
javascript要學多久?
從0基礎到勉強能用,只求入門的話2-3個月綽綽有餘,但是要精通的話肯定是需要花更多時間日積月累了,選擇培訓的話是要參與一些項目聯練習的,因為JavaScript很多技巧不通過項目這樣比較大的歷練是用不上的。千鋒官網每日更新最新軟體開發基礎知識內容,鞏固日常學習中的基礎技能。更有免費的軟體開發視頻教程幫助學員快速學習。 千鋒教育就有線上免費的軟體開發公開課,。
Web前端培訓多長時間,只能說簡單入門在五到六個月,真正要達到精通級別的話,需要天賦跟經驗的積累。正所謂,一入前端深似海,從此回首無邊界。活到老,學到老。只要步入了前端開發你就會發現,前端真的是要一直不停的學,不停的學。千鋒教育集團目前已與國內4000多家企業建立人才輸送合作,與500多所大學建立實訓就業合作,每年為各大企業輸送上萬名移動開發工程師,每年有數十萬名學員受益於千鋒教育組織的技術研討會、技術培訓課、網路公開課及免費教學視頻。
Javascript 怎麼學習DOM編程
dom–文檔對象模型,簡單點說就是將你的客戶端(IE/火狐等)以樹狀結構從大到小拆分成單一的對象讓你操作。
誇張點說,你在客戶端(瀏覽器)所看到的一切元素,js都可以操作。
如果你學過其他語言,特別是java或C#有對象的概念,相信對於dom上手很快的。 你不用去定義類,去實例對象,你只要會用這些已有的對象就行了。
dom樹其實就是你可以想像的你的頁面構造
window(窗體對象)-document(文檔對象)-documentElement(文檔內容的根)-body-table-tr-td-span…..
JS裡面的DOM操作是什麼
DOM(即 Document Object Mode) 是 W3C(萬維網聯盟)的標準。
DOM 定義了訪問 HTML 和 XML 文檔的標準:「W3C 文檔對象模型 (DOM) 是中立於平台和語言的介面,它允許程序和腳本動態地訪問和更新文檔的內容、結構和樣式。」
W3C DOM 標準被分為 3 個不同的部分:
核心 DOM – 針對任何結構化文檔的標準模型
XML DOM – 針對 XML 文檔的標準模型
HTML DOM – 針對 HTML 文檔的標準模型
其中,在 HTML DOM 中,所有事物都是節點。DOM 是被視為節點樹的 HTML。
根據 W3C 的 HTML DOM 標準,HTML 文檔中的所有內容都是節點:
整個文檔是一個文檔節點
每個 HTML 元素是元素節點
HTML 元素內的文本是文本節點
每個 HTML 屬性是屬性節點
注釋是注釋節點
HTML DOM 將 HTML 文檔視作樹結構。這種結構被稱為節點樹。通過 HTML DOM,樹中的所有節點均可通過 JavaScript 進行訪問。所有 HTML 元素(節點)均可被修改,也可以創建或刪除節點。
DOM 處理中的常見錯誤是希望元素節點包含文本。
舉個栗子:titleDOM 教程/title,元素節點 title,包含值為 “DOM 教程” 的文本節點。
可通過節點的 innerHTML 屬性來訪問文本節點的值。
一些常用的 HTML DOM 方法:
getElementById(id) – 獲取帶有指定 id 的節點(元素)
appendChild(node) – 插入新的子節點(元素)
removeChild(node) – 刪除子節點(元素)
一些常用的 HTML DOM 屬性:
innerHTML – 節點(元素)的文本值
parentNode – 節點(元素)的父節點
childNodes – 節點(元素)的子節點
attributes – 節點(元素)的屬性節點
DOM操作示例
html
body
p id=”p1″Hello World!/p
script
document.getElementById(“p1″).innerHTML=”New text!”;
//內容變更為new text
document.getElementById(“p1″).style.color=”blue”;
//藍色
/script
/body
/html
原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/182924.html